DESCRIPTION
NEC's
µPG2301TQ
is a GaAs HBT MMIC for power amplifier
for Bluetooth Class 1.
This device realizes high efficiency, high gain and high
output power by using InGaP HBT. This device is housed in
a low profile 10-pin plastic TSON package.
APPLICATION
• POWER AMPLIFIER FOR BLUETOOTH CLASS 1
• WIRELESS LAN
